Core Functionality
This sensor operates as an impulse generator, converting mechanical rotation of the crankshaft into electrical signals. Each revolution generates a series of pulses that accurately represent the crankshaft’s angular position and speed. The ECU interprets these pulses to synchronize ignition events with optimal engine timing.

Diagnostic Considerations
Engine control modules typically monitor crankshaft position sensors through di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s). Common issues include:
- P0335: Crankshaft Position Sensor A Circuit Malfunction – may indicate a faulty sensor or wiring problem.
- P0340: Crankshaft Position Sensor B Circuit Malfunction – often related to secondary sensor failures in dual‑sensor setups.
When diagnosing, check for:
- Signal continuity and proper voltage supply.
- Physical damage or corrosion on connector pins.
- Proper alignment with the crankshaft gear teeth to ensure accurate pulse generation.
